Vitals: : The Heat and Bulls met four times this regular season with the teams splitting the series, 2-2. The Heat are 64-65 all-time versus
the Bulls during the regular season, including 37-28 in home games and 27-37 in road games. This marks the second time the Heat and Bulls will
meet in a Play-In game after Miami recorded a, 102-91, win last season to secure the eighth seed on their way to winning the Eastern Conference
and an NBA Finals appearance. The Bulls are coming off a victory against the Atlanta Hawks in the other Play-In Game. Coby White had 42 points, marking the second-most points scored by any player in Play-In
Tournament history behind Jayson Tatum's 50 points.
